The 6' x 5' Shire Pixie Children's/ Kids' Wooden Garden Playhouse (1.79m x 1.68m) is a charming wooden Wendy house, expertly built and boasting a number of impressive features. Constructed from 12mm tongue and groove cladding, well-known for its weather resistance, durability and strength, this children's playhouse further benefits from robust 34x34mm framing. The floor is 12mm tongue and groove too, ready to withstand years of children's games and footfall. The apex roof is 11mm OSB board, finished in felt to ensure a weatherproof interior. Its decorative scalloped edge and finials add an attractive touch. The overhang of the roof allows for a small veranda framed by the 2 side railings. The entrance door features a large framed window and a cottage-style ring latch. Two further large opening windows allow light and fresh air to flood into the interior, as well as completing the playhouse's pretty appearance. The glazing is made from styrene, which is virtually shatter proof and far safer than glass. This kids' playhouse comes with a beautiful smooth-planed finish, rounded safety edges and complies with BS5665 EN71 safety standards. The Shire Pixie is supplied dip treated with a 10-year anti-rot guarantee, when supported with annual retreatment.
